Abstract
We describe the case of a female patient with severe acute pancreatitis of biliary origin who presented with clinical deterioration. A thrombosis of the superior mesenteric artery and hepatic artery was identified as the cause, thus creating a rare vascular complication. She was taken for pharmacological and mechanical thrombectomy, with the subsequent death of the patient. Arterial vascular complications are an entity little recognized in the medical literature; they have a high mortality rate and pose a significant diagnostic and therapeutic challenge.
